Output 138d295977d4d26692eaaf7de50954bec80f61a4f2fa79cc7dc22a7c6876de92:0

value
18616788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f679a135c7387959befce225f064a482b60cf3d OP_EQUAL
address
3LbfudqYKvg826Cs4piSgnFQM6aJvYCpWy
transaction
138d295977d4d26692eaaf7de50954bec80f61a4f2fa79cc7dc22a7c6876de92
spent
true